Tabla de contenido:

Altavoz Darth Vader: 8 pasos (con imágenes)
Altavoz Darth Vader: 8 pasos (con imágenes)

Video: Altavoz Darth Vader: 8 pasos (con imágenes)

Video: Altavoz Darth Vader: 8 pasos (con imágenes)
Video: EL INCREIBLE HOMBRE SPIDERMAN! 8 2024, Noviembre
Anonim
Image
Image
Altavoz de Darth Vader
Altavoz de Darth Vader

Si eres un gran fanático de las películas de Star Wars, sigue los pasos a continuación para crear tu propio altavoz Darth Vader. Como parte de la construcción, usaremos una Raspberry Pi Zero W como el corazón del proyecto, y un amplificador mono I2S clase D y un altavoz de 4 ohmios, para tocar nuestras canciones favoritas.

En mi caso, tengo canciones en mp3 que he ido recopilando a lo largo de los años, que las he descargado en la tarjeta SD de mi Pi y ejecuto un software llamado Mopidy, que es un servidor de música extensible escrito en Python. Y puede reproducir canciones usando un navegador web en su teléfono móvil / tableta / computadora portátil como ve en el video.

Además, si tiene su colección de canciones en línea en Spotify, SoundCloud o Google Play Music, puede instalar una extensión mopidy para reproducir canciones de su colección además de las canciones en el Pi.

Paso 1: Cosas que necesitará para completar la compilación

Cosas que necesitará para completar la compilación
Cosas que necesitará para completar la compilación
Cosas que necesitará para completar la compilación
Cosas que necesitará para completar la compilación

Aquí está la lista de componentes electrónicos que necesitará

  • Raspberry Pi Zero W
  • Adaptador de amplificador Adafruit I2S 3W Clase D - MAX98357A
  • Altavoz - 3 "de diámetro - 4 ohmios 3 vatios
  • Cables de puente hembra / hembra

Otras cosas que necesitas

  • Filamento 3D Negro - PLA 1,75 mm
  • Kit de renuncia Z Poxy para el acabado de la cabeza Vader impresa en 3D

Herramientas que necesitarás

  • Varillas de pegamento caliente y pistola
  • impresora 3d
  • Bolígrafo 3D para unir las piezas
  • Herramienta rotativa como una Dremel para lijar las piezas más rápido.
  • Cuchillo Xacto
  • papel de lija para limpiar las impresiones 3D
  • Contenedor para mezclar el renunciar
  • Guantes y gafas de seguridad
  • Soldador y soldadura

Paso 2: Imprima en 3D los archivos STL adjuntos

Imprima en 3D los archivos STL adjuntos
Imprima en 3D los archivos STL adjuntos
Imprima en 3D los archivos STL adjuntos
Imprima en 3D los archivos STL adjuntos

Descargue los archivos STL adjuntos y, con el software de impresión 3D, corte e imprima los archivos en 3D. Si no tiene una impresora 3D a mano, puede usar una en su club de fabricantes o biblioteca local o usar un servicio de impresión 3D como 3D Hubs.

En mi caso, imprimí los archivos STl utilizando Flashforge creator pro y PLA negro de 1,75 mm para imprimir. Además para cortar, estoy usando Slic3r con la altura de la capa establecida en 0.3 mm y la densidad de relleno en el 25%.

Se puede encontrar el filamento negro de 1,75 mm utilizado:

Paso 3: juntar piezas de PLA con lápiz de impresión 3D

Colocación de piezas de PLA con lápiz de impresión 3D
Colocación de piezas de PLA con lápiz de impresión 3D
Colocación de piezas de PLA con lápiz de impresión 3D
Colocación de piezas de PLA con lápiz de impresión 3D
Colocación de piezas de PLA con lápiz de impresión 3D
Colocación de piezas de PLA con lápiz de impresión 3D

Ahora, para armar la pieza en lugar de usar superpegamento, usaremos un bolígrafo de impresión 3D.

Una vez que tenga sus piezas impresas, use la herramienta Rotativa en mi caso un Dremel / papel de lija para limar los bordes de las piezas a armar. Use una pistola de pegamento caliente para unir las piezas, esto mantendrá temporalmente la pieza en su lugar y facilitará el uso de la pluma de impresión 3D para derretir PLA en el interior de la pieza.

Ahora, una vez que haya terminado el interior de su pieza, retire el pegamento caliente con un cuchillo xacto desde el exterior como se muestra en la imagen de arriba, y saque el filamento del lápiz para aplicarlo en el exterior de la pieza.

Nota

¡Usar este método puede poner a prueba tu paciencia!, así que recuerda tomar descansos.

Además, recuerde hacer esto en un área bien ventilada y use gafas protectoras para cubrirse los ojos mientras lija.

Paso 4: lijado y más lijado …

Lijado y más lijado …
Lijado y más lijado …
Lijado y más lijado …
Lijado y más lijado …
Lijado y más lijado …
Lijado y más lijado …

¡Ahora viene la parte difícil, lijar!

Use una herramienta rotativa como Dremel para acelerar el proceso de lijado y usan papel de lija. Lave la pieza una vez que haya terminado, verá marcas de arena en la pieza impresa en 3D como se muestra arriba, pero eso no debería ser un problema ya que la terminará con uno de los pasos que se mencionan a continuación.

Dado que ha utilizado un bolígrafo de impresión 3D con el mismo filamento con el que imprimió los archivos STL, este método evitará que las piezas se deshagan en unos meses, en comparación con si hubiera utilizado pegamento caliente.

Paso 5: Aplicación de Z Poxy

Aplicación de Z Poxy
Aplicación de Z Poxy
Aplicación de Z Poxy
Aplicación de Z Poxy
Aplicación de Z Poxy
Aplicación de Z Poxy

Como parte del kit Z poxy viene con dos botellas, una contiene la resina y la otra el endurecedor.

Vierta aproximadamente cantidades iguales de resina y endurecedor en un recipiente. Mézclelo con la punta de un pincel o una de sus impresiones de prueba, esto toma alrededor de 3-4 minutos y espere hasta que el líquido se vuelva blanquecino. Use una combinación de pinceles pequeños y grandes para pintar el modelo, comience con la parte de la impresión 3D que tiene más detalles, como los ojos y la boca de la maceta Darth Vader. Deje que la pieza se seque durante al menos 4 horas y manténgala alejada del polvo. El tiempo de 4 horas puede variar y depende de las porciones de endurecedor y resina.

Aquí la apuesta más segura es dejar secar la pieza durante la noche. No levantes la pieza antes de que se seque por completo, o terminarás dejando tus huellas dactilares en el modelo. Si no tiene Z Poxy disponible, también puede probar XTC-3D y comprar una empresa llamada Smooth-On.

Consejos para aplicar Z Poxy a la pieza impresa en 3D

  • Compre el Z Poxy que dice 30 minutos en él, para que tenga más tiempo para trabajar con la solución antes de que se ponga difícil.
  • Si está aplicando esto a figuras pequeñas, es posible que desee pegar con pegamento caliente la base de la pieza impresa en 3D a la pieza de madera, para que usar el pincel sea mucho más fácil y no deje huellas dactilares / marcas de guantes en el modelo..
  • Además, intente colocar su modelo en una base que pueda mover como una caja o un trozo de madera, si no tiene una de esas elegantes mesas giratorias.
  • Prueba y usa un recipiente de tupperware transparente para que puedas ver que la mezcla se torna de un color blanco turbio.
  • Haga esto en un área bien ventilada, aunque dice que es inodoro en la caja, tiene un ligero olor acre.
  • Use guantes, ya que esta solución se puede adherir a las manos como un pegamento y puede ser difícil quitarla.
  • Intente mantener su modelo a temperatura ambiente, entre 15 y 30 C y alejado del polvo.

Paso 6: Conexiones del circuito

Conexiones de circuito
Conexiones de circuito

Suelde los pines del cabezal en la Raspberry Pi Zero W y también suelde el altavoz a + ve y -ve en el amplificador Adafruit MAX98357 I2S Class-D.

Y aquí están las conexiones de pines entre el Raspberry Pi Zero W y el amplificador MAX98357 I2S Class-D.

  • Vin al pin 4 en Pi 5V
  • GND al pin 9 Pi GND
  • DIN al pin 40 en el Pi
  • BCLK al pin 12
  • LRCLK al pin 35

Paso 7: Configuración de Raspbian e instalación de Mopidy Music Player en la Pi

Configuración de Raspbian e instalación de Mopidy Music Player en la Pi
Configuración de Raspbian e instalación de Mopidy Music Player en la Pi

Usando su computadora, actualice la última versión de Rasbian-lite img en una tarjeta SD (enlace de descarga para el archivo img https://www.raspberrypi.org/downloads/raspbian/). Y luego agregue la tarjeta SD a la Raspberry Pi y conecte su Pi al enrutador WiFi y tome nota de la dirección IP, luego SSH en su Pi

Comience ejecutando los dos comandos a continuación para actualizar y actualizar los paquetes en la Pi.

sudo apt-get update

sudo apt-get upgrade

Ahora para configurar y probar el amplificador mono MAX98357 I2S Class-D de Adafruit, siga la guía del sistema Adafruit Learning en: https://learn.adafruit.com/adafruit-max98357-i2s-class-d-mono-amp/pinouts ? ver = todo. Básicamente, como parte de la configuración, hay una configuración fácil y una configuración difícil, si planea ejecutar la ruta fácil, simplemente descargue y ejecute el siguiente script de shell

curl -s https://raw.githubusercontent.com/adafruit/Raspberry-Pi-Installer-Scripts/master/i2samp.sh | intento

Para verificar si el script de shell se ejecutó correctamente y si puede escuchar el sonido del altavoz, ejecute

altavoz-prueba -c2 --test = wav -w /usr/share/sounds/alsa/Front_Center.wav

Y para ajustar el volumen usa el comando alsamixer

Configuración de Mopidy para reproducir sus canciones favoritas Ahora para reproducir sus canciones favoritas, vamos a configurar Mopidy y un cliente web para mopidy, para que pueda reproducir su canción desde su móvil / mesa. Mopidy reproduce música desde el disco local, Spotify, SoundCloud, Google Play Music y más. Puede editar la lista de reproducción desde cualquier teléfono, tableta o computadora utilizando una variedad de clientes web y MPD.

Ahora instalemos Mopidy ejecute el siguiente comando

sudo apt-get install mopidy

para obtener más información, consulte la documentación en - Instalación - Documentación de Mopidy 2.0.1

Modifique mopidy.conf para habilitar las secciones HTTP, MPD y Archivos, aquí está mi mopidy.conf, y mi directorio local para almacenar musing es / home / pi / Music, por lo que si planea usar el archivo.conf a continuación, cree un Directorio "Música" en la carpeta de inicio

sudo nano /etc/mopidy/mopidy.conf

He adjuntado mi mopidy.conf, por si desea hacer una copia.

Si planea usar una aplicación web en el teléfono / tableta, necesitará un cliente web http, me gusta Mopidy-Mobile..

sudo pip instalar Mopidy-Mobile

Para ejecutar mopidy en el arranque, ejecute y reinicie su pi

sudo systemctl habilitar mopidy

sudo reiniciar

Además, si planea cargar más archivos mp3 /.wav en la carpeta Música en el futuro, tendrá que ejecutar un comando de escaneo, para que las canciones aparezcan en el cliente Mopidy-Mobile usando

sudo mopidyctl escaneo local

Y luego use la URL abierta del cliente móvil en su navegador en su dispositivo móvil / computadora - https:// IpAddressOfPi: 6680 / y reproduzca sus melodías y canciones favoritas, en mi caso, descargué algunas canciones de creative commons de la biblioteca de audio de youtube para el demostración de vídeo, que se ve en la captura de pantalla anterior.

Paso 8: Adición de la electrónica a la pieza impresa en 3D de Darth Vader

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ader
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ader
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ader
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ader
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ader
Adición de componentes electrónicos a la pieza impresa en 3D de Darth Vader

Para agregar los componentes a las piezas impresas en 3D, utilicé pegamento caliente para conectar el amplificador Raspberry Pi Zero y MAX98357 I2S Class-D y pasar el cable USB desde la parte posterior.

Además, pegué en caliente ambos componentes del altavoz, y esta parte debería encajar a presión en la cabeza de Darth Vader.

Ahora, para que el reproductor de música Mopidy se inicie cada vez que se enciende el Pi, podemos configurar Mopidy para que se ejecute como un servicio del sistema, utilizando systemd puede habilitar el servicio Mopidy ejecutando:

sudo systemctl habilitar mopidy

Esto hará que Mopidy se inicie automáticamente cuando se inicie el sistema. Y Mopidy se inicia, detiene y reinicia como cualquier otro servicio systemd, usando

sudo systemctl iniciar mopidy

sudo systemctl detener mopidy sudo systemctl reiniciar mopidy

Además, si tiene su colección de canciones en línea en Spotify, SoundCloud o Google Play Music, puede instalar una extensión mopidy para reproducir canciones de su colección además de las canciones en el Pi.

Recomendado: